What is Aeronautical Engineering Course?

Aeronautical Engineering course deals with the designing, manufacturing and maintenance of flight machines and aircraft. It is a niche domain which is under development in our country and provides great career opportunities not only in India but in foreign nations also. 

Course Spans:

Here's a breakdown of Aeronautical Engineering Courses in India in points:

Focus: Design, development, testing, and maintenance of aircraft within Earth's atmosphere (differs from Aerospace Engineering which covers spacecraft too).

Degree: Typically a 4-year Bachelor of Technology (BTech) or Bachelor of Engineering (BE) program.

Course Structure: Blends theoretical knowledge (aerodynamics, propulsion) with practical applications (aircraft structures, flight control).

Who can pursue Aeronautical Engineering?

Individuals who have completed Class 12th with Physics, Chemistry, and Mathematics (PCM) are eligible to pursue Aeronautical Engineering courses after 12th. Some institutions might consider candidates with Physics, Chemistry, and Biology (PCB) but this is less common.

Aptitude and Interest:

  • A strong aptitude for science and mathematics, particularly physics, is crucial.
  • A keen interest in aviation, aircraft, and understanding how they fly is essential for motivation and success.
  • Problem-solving and analytical skills are highly valuable in this field.

Aeronautical Engineering Syllabus

The course curriculum for Aeronautical Engineering consists of various core and elective subjects which provide exposure to the nuances of aircraft manufacturing and handling. It consists of various core and elective subjects and candidates are required to complete practical courses and project work in order to successfully learn the nuances of Aeronautical Engineering. Any Aeronautical Engineering course comprises the following subjects/topics:

Aeronautical Engineering Subjects- Semester 1

  • Mathematics
  • Introduction to Aerospace Engineering
  • Engineering Physics
  • Basic Electrical Engineering
  • Engineering Chemistry

Aeronautical Engineering Subjects- Semester 2

  • Vector Calculus and Ordinary Differential Equations
  • Basic Electronics Engineering
  • Physics II
  • Engineering Graphics
  • Materials Science and Metallurgy

Aeronautical Engineering Subjects- Semester 3

  • Engineering Thermodynamics 
  • Manufacturing Technology
  • Mechanics of Solids
  • Introduction to Machine Elements and Drawing
  • Fluid Mechanics

Aeronautical Engineering Subjects- Semester 4

  • Aerodynamics
  • Machining and Precision Manufacturing
  • Heat Transfer
  • Introduction to Social Science and Ethics
  • Applied Dynamics and Vibration

Aeronautical Engineering Subjects- Semester 5

  • Compressible Flow
  • Theory of Elasticity
  • Atmospheric Flight Mechanics
  • Automatic Control
  • Spaceflight Mechanics

Aeronautical Engineering Subjects- Semester 6

  • Air-Breathing Propulsion
  • Principles of Management Systems
  • Aerospace Structures
  • Solar Thermal Energy
  • Optimization Techniques in Engineering

Aeronautical Engineering Subjects- Semester 7

  • AerospaceAerospace Vehicle Design
  • Two-Phase Flow and Heat Transfer
  • Environmental Science and Engineering
  • Flight Mechanics and Propulsion Lab
  • Structural Dynamics

Aeronautical Engineering Subjects- Semester 8

  • Comprehensive Viva-Voce
  • Project Work
